The first step to fix a hole on an air mattress, without patch is to identify and then clean the hole. Be sure to inspect every surface to see if there are holes. If you spot one, use a moist cloth to wash the surface around the hole. This will allow you to identify the problem more quickly and will make the repair more smooth. This also stops any dirt or debris from getting in the hole and making the fix more complicated.

After you’ve cleaned the area surrounding the hole and applied the adhesive, you’re now ready to apply glue around the hole. Based on the type of glue you’ve used, you may need to apply it using a brush. apply it to the edges of the hole. Make sure to keep within the circumference of the hole and apply an even layer of glue. Be sure not to get too much glue in the inner layers of your mattress. Once you’ve applied the glue, wait for it to completely dry before proceeding.
After applying the glue to the hole, it’s crucial to allow the glue to dry prior to moving on. It could take between 15 minutes to one hour, depending on the kind of glue you use. Make sure the glue completely is dry before you can inflate the mattress. If the glue is not completely dry the mattress will not be able to hold air. Furthermore when the glue is still wet, it could be very difficult to pump up.
